MILLENNIALS ARE LOOKING FOR HOMES TO PURCHASE

More millennials are getting ready to join the millions of people in homeownership. This could mean the demand for homes in the starter and mid-level range will continue to be healthy.

Mark Fleming, Chief Economist of First American Financial Corporation, stated, “The largest group of millennials by birth year will turn 30 in 2020, which puts them entering their prime homebuying years. Millennials—the most educated generation—have the highest incomes across their generational cohorts, even when salaries are adjusted for inflation.”

Millennials have more buying power than the generations that preceded them, making their interest in homeownership stronger.  This could be positive towards the continuing growth rate in the real estate market.

Fleming went on to say, “We expect the homeownership rate to close the gap with potential in the years further ahead as millennials continue to make important decisions, such as attaining education and, later in life, getting married and having children.”’

Frank Martell, President, and CEO of CoreLogic, stated, about interest rates, “Lower rates are certainly making it more affordable to buy homes and millennial buyers are entering the market with increasing force. These positive demand drivers, which are occurring against a backdrop of persistent shortages in housing stock, are the major drivers for higher home prices, which will likely continue to rise for the foreseeable future.”
